Foundation of the ottoman empire (1299)- summary: The ottoman empire was founded by Osman | in Anatolia. At first, they were a small empire, but they expanded through conquests and alliances- question: How did alliances help them expand

Fall of Constantinople (1453)- summary: Mehmed || led the capture of Constantinople from the Byzantine Empire. They breached the city's walls and renamed it Istanbul, marking the end of the Byzantine Empire- question: Why was the conquest of Constantinople an important point in history

Suleiman the Magnificent (1520-1566)- summary: The ottoman Empire reached it's peak when being ruled by Suleiman. He expanded the empire into Europe, reformed the legal system, and promoted arts architecture.- question: What did he do differently to achieve his success ?
Decline of the Ottoman Empire (17th-20th century)- summary: The empire weakened because of corruptions, military defeats, and they struggled to adapt to modern technology. The empire officially ended the Ottoman Empire- question: What other factors lead to the decline?
